PIANEGONDA BY MARCANTONIO

Sometimes, beauty lies in diversity. In a creative act, where the diversity of elements is expressive power, fragments joined together are shaped, transforming into unique jewels.

This reflection led to the collaboration with Italian artist and designer Marcantonio Raimondi Malerba, who created the IMPERFECTUM capsule collection for Pianegonda.

A new design narrative capable of capturing time, encasing it like a precious material. For the creation of IMPERFECTUM, Marcantonio was inspired by the ancient Japanese technique of Kintsugi, reinterpreting it into a new concept of contemporary jewelry.

The “art of mending” becomes the main narrative of an artistic approach that turns imperfect elements into a new form of beauty. For beauty also lies in imperfection. With IMPERFECTUM, Marcantonio explored the Pianegonda aesthetics through his creative vision, designing jewelry pieces that are much more than luxury accessories, but become authentic design objects.

PIANEGONDA & ISTITUTO MARANGONI MILANO

The brand collaborates with Istituto Marangoni Milano – The School Of Designto discover and promote young emerging designers from around the world.

Pianegonda's aesthetic codes served as creative inspiration for the "Harmonic Resonances" and "Precious Harmonies" projects, developed by the brand with students. New forms of jewelry resulted from the creative vision of future designers, who interpreted the brand's ethos without sacrificing the expression of their own history and artistic sensibility.
